Far-Western Provincial Assembly urges central government to demand removal of Indian troops from disputed land

The Far-Western Provincial Assembly has passed a resolution calling on Nepal’s central government to take the initiative to remove Indian troops from the encroached land through diplomatic channels and to claim the land that rightfully belongs to Nepal. The proposal was passed by a majority in the state assembly meeting held on Wednesday.

The resolution was put forth by state assembly member Karna Bahadur Malla on January 6 with the support of state assembly member Bharat Bahadur Khadka. Then again, on June 6, Karna Bahadur Malla and Gyalbu Singh Bohara, with the support of members Bharat Khadka, Lal Bahadur Khadka and Malamati Kumari Rana, had registered a joint proposal to remove the Indian Army and claim the land of Limpiyadhura, Lipulek and Kalapani areas as soon as possible.
